Output 3c20952429b99df2004e2ca3284f684a78b9b0e8ed3cc82db67705a58b33e6c7:5

value
2887907
script pubkey
OP_0 OP_PUSHBYTES_20 d0c7871753b4c326adc21df47afa5c970f020450
address
bc1q6rrcw96nknpjdtwzrh6847juju8sypzs7uflt7
transaction
3c20952429b99df2004e2ca3284f684a78b9b0e8ed3cc82db67705a58b33e6c7
spent
true